As a seasoned e-learning critic, I find this course to be a solid introduction to requirements engineering. The real-life examples offer valuable insights into the application of various requirement gathering methods. However, there are some areas for improvement, such as addressing the issues with course resources and enhancing sound quality. With a few tweaks, this course could better support business analysts seeking practical guidance in their day-to-day roles. Despite its shortcomings, "Business Analysis: Developing Requirements" remains a valuable resource for those looking to expand their understanding of requirements development methodologies.
What We Liked
- Covers a wide range of requirement gathering methods including interviews, observations, and group sessions
- Includes real-life examples to help illustrate concepts and techniques
- Provides a clear introduction to the basics of requirements engineering
- Engaging tone and approach that makes the content easy to understand
Potential Drawbacks
- Some users mention issues with the course resources, such as file formats and non-functioning downloads
- A few users note that the sound quality can be an issue, making it difficult to stay focused
- Lacks in-depth exploration of certain topics like JAD, JRP, and focus groups
- At least one user notes a lack of response to questions or inquiries
